How to: Create XML Indexes

Use an XML index to create indexes for columns of the data type XML, which cannot be indexed using the Index/Keys dialog box. Each XML column can have more than one XML index, but the first one created (primary) will be the basis of the others. If you delete the primary XML index, the others will also be deleted.

To create an XML index

  1. In the Server Explorer, right-click the table for which you want to create an XML index and click Open Table Definition.

    The table opens in Table Designer.

  2. Select the XML column for the index.

  3. From the Table Designer menu, click XML Index.

  4. In the Full-text Index dialog box, click Add.

  5. Select the new index in the Selected XML Index list and set properties for the index in the grid to the right.
